--- Comment #7 from jbeulich at suse dot com ---
For the problem originally reported here (operator name space collision) a
workaround could be introduced (e.g. a new operand to .intel_syntax to allow
suppressing the recognition of MASM-like operands). I don't, however, see any
option for register names (besides ".intel_syntax prefix" of course, but aiui
this wouldn't work with the output gcc produces, and of course this mode isn't
really "Intel Syntax" anymore anyway).
